Chrapowo [xraˈpɔvɔ]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Pełczyce, within Choszczno County, West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-western Poland.[1] It lies approximately 4 kilometres (2 mi) west of Pełczyce, 17 km (11 mi) south-west of Choszczno, and 61 km (38 mi) south-east of the regional capital Szczecin.

For the history of the region, see History of Pomerania.

The village has a population of 320.
